Lack of Access to Suppliers

One of the main barriers that phlebotomists in rural areas face when trying to procure necessary medical equipment and devices is the lack of access to suppliers. Unlike their counterparts in urban areas, phlebotomists in rural areas may not have easy access to medical supply companies that can provide them with the tools they need. This can make it difficult for them to obtain items such as needles, tubes, syringes, and other equipment that are essential for their work.

Without access to reliable suppliers, phlebotomists in rural areas may be forced to travel long distances to obtain the necessary equipment, which can be time-consuming and costly. This lack of access to suppliers can also lead to delays in procuring equipment, which can impact the quality of care that phlebotomists are able to provide to their patients.

Limited Resources

In addition to a lack of access to suppliers, phlebotomists in rural areas also face challenges due to limited resources. Rural healthcare facilities often have smaller budgets and fewer staff members than their urban counterparts, which can make it difficult for them to invest in the latest medical equipment and devices. This lack of resources can hinder the ability of phlebotomists in rural areas to obtain the tools they need to perform their jobs effectively.

Furthermore, phlebotomists in rural areas may also have limited access to training and education on how to use new equipment and devices. Without the proper training, phlebotomists may struggle to effectively utilize new tools, which can impact the quality of care they are able to provide to their patients. Limited resources can also make it challenging for rural healthcare facilities to stay up-to-date with the latest technology and best practices in phlebotomy.

Challenges in Telemedicine

While telemedicine and online ordering have helped to bridge the gap for phlebotomists in rural areas, there are still challenges that need to be addressed. One of the main challenges is the lack of reliable internet access in rural areas, which can make it difficult for phlebotomists to place orders for medical equipment and devices online. Without reliable internet access, phlebotomists may struggle to access the online resources they need to obtain the necessary tools for their work.

Furthermore, some rural healthcare facilities may not have the infrastructure in place to support telemedicine and online ordering. This can make it difficult for phlebotomists to take advantage of these technologies and platforms, which can hinder their ability to procure the equipment and devices they need to provide quality care to their patients. More needs to be done to ensure that phlebotomists in rural areas have access to the technology and resources they need to effectively obtain the tools they need for their work.
